首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

jupyter notebook中的ModuleNotFoundError

在Jupyter Notebook中出现ModuleNotFoundError错误通常是由于缺少所需的模块或库导致的。该错误表示Python解释器无法找到所需的模块。

解决这个问题的方法有以下几种:

  1. 确保模块已经安装:首先,你需要确保所需的模块已经在你的环境中安装。你可以使用pip命令来安装模块,例如:!pip install 模块名。如果你使用的是conda环境,可以使用!conda install 模块名来安装。
  2. 检查模块名称拼写:请确保你在导入模块时使用了正确的模块名称,并且没有拼写错误。
  3. 检查模块是否在搜索路径中:Python解释器会在特定的搜索路径中查找模块。你可以使用以下代码来查看Python的搜索路径:
代码语言:txt
复制
import sys
print(sys.path)

确保所需的模块所在的路径在搜索路径中。如果模块不在搜索路径中,你可以使用以下代码将其添加到搜索路径中:

代码语言:txt
复制
import sys
sys.path.append("模块路径")
  1. 重新启动内核:有时候,重新启动Jupyter Notebook的内核也可以解决ModuleNotFoundError错误。你可以在Notebook界面中选择"Kernel" -> "Restart"来重新启动内核。

总结起来,解决ModuleNotFoundError错误的关键是确保所需的模块已经正确安装,并且在Python的搜索路径中可用。如果问题仍然存在,你可以尝试重新启动内核或者检查模块名称拼写是否正确。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Jupyter Notebook

    背景: Jupyter Notebook是基于网页用于交互计算应用程序。其可被应用于全过程计算:开发、文档编写、运行代码和展示结果。...——Jupyter Notebook官方介绍 Python最著名IDE之一,可以直接使用浏览器界面,图形化做也很漂亮。...以前一直使用是ipython,以及ipython qtconsole,今天尝试下jupyter notebook 安装: #启动我科学计算环境 1: conda activate sci #安装jupyter...2: pip install jupyter #生成配置文件 3: jupyter notebook --generate-config #创建密码 #打开pytho终端,输入python 4: from...7:此时,转移到你台式机终端 (1)按照网上教程一般会直接浏览器输入 https://ip:8888 But,我这边始终不work,没办法只好自立更生 (2)台式机终端: ssh -N -f -

    93610

    Jupyter Notebook

    文件夹启动 Jupyter 主界面,如下所示: ?...例如,如果想在 notebook 添加 Jupyter logo,将其大小设置为 100px x 100px,并且放置在单元格左侧,可以这样编写: <img src="http://blog.<em>jupyter</em>.org...要想在 <em>Jupyter</em> <em>notebook</em> 中使用 matplotlib,需要告诉 <em>Jupyter</em> 获取 matplotlib 生成<em>的</em>所有图形,并将其嵌入 <em>notebook</em> <em>中</em>。...在上一篇文章<em>中</em>,你有没有注意启动 <em>Jupyter</em> 时出现过这样一段话: The IPython <em>Notebook</em> is running at: http://localhost:8888/ 这意味着,你<em>的</em>...结语 从这两篇快速入门介绍<em>中</em>,我们可以看到:<em>Jupyter</em> <em>notebook</em> 是一个非常强大<em>的</em>工具,可以创建漂亮<em>的</em>交互式文档,制作教学材料,等等。

    1.6K30

    Jupyter Notebook

    文件夹启动 Jupyter 主界面,如下所示: ?...例如,如果想在 notebook 添加 Jupyter logo,将其大小设置为 100px x 100px,并且放置在单元格左侧,可以这样编写: <img src="http://blog.<em>jupyter</em>.org...要想在 <em>Jupyter</em> <em>notebook</em> 中使用 matplotlib,需要告诉 <em>Jupyter</em> 获取 matplotlib 生成<em>的</em>所有图形,并将其嵌入 <em>notebook</em> <em>中</em>。...在上一篇文章<em>中</em>,你有没有注意启动 <em>Jupyter</em> 时出现过这样一段话: The IPython <em>Notebook</em> is running at: http://localhost:8888/ 这意味着,你<em>的</em>...结语 从这两篇快速入门介绍<em>中</em>,我们可以看到:<em>Jupyter</em> <em>notebook</em> 是一个非常强大<em>的</em>工具,可以创建漂亮<em>的</em>交互式文档,制作教学材料,等等。

    1.7K80

    Jupyter notebook 使用

    Jupyter notebook 是一种 Web 应用,它能让用户将说明文本、数学方程、代码和可视化内容全部组合到一个易于共享文档,非常方便研究和教学。...在原始 Python shell 与 IPython ,可视化在单独窗口中进行,而文字资料以及各种函数和类脚本包含在独立文档。...1 安装 通过安装Anaconda来解决Jupyter Notebook安装问题,因为Anaconda已经自动为你安装了Jupter Notebook及其他工具,还有python超过180个科学包及其依赖项...2 修改默认工作目录 在cmd输入 jupyter notebook --generate-config 如果该配置文件已经存在,那么,会出现如下信息,从中可以见到配置文件存在位置,注意,此时,输入...= 'D:\workspace\jupyter_notebook' 有个问题,从命令行输入jupyter notebook时候发现目录已经更改了,但是点击桌面的jupyter图标打开目录依然没有修改

    1.4K20

    Jupyter Notebook使用

    介绍 Jupyter Notebook有两种不同键盘输入模式。编辑模式允许输入代码/文本到一个单元格,并以绿色单元格边框表示,此时命令模式快捷键不起作用。...命令模式将键盘绑定到计算机级别的操作,并由具有蓝色左边距灰色单元格边框指示,可以用快捷键命令运行单元格,移动单元格,切换单元格编辑状态等,此时编辑模式下快捷键不起作用。 2....快捷键 快捷键可以在Jupyter Notebook顶部Help > Keyboard Shortcuts查看。 ? ? ? 3....次,显示最快三次均值 %%timeit # 将当前单元代码输出到文件 %%writefile a.py # 显示文件内容 %pycat a.py # 执行shell命令,以!...ls 参考资料 https://www.dataquest.io/blog/jupyter-notebook-tips-tricks-shortcuts/

    63310

    CSharp for Jupyter Notebook

    之前说有机会就说下Linux下如何搭建C#版交互编程,今天写篇文章还债^_^ Win下比较简单,可以自己看官方文档https://github.com/zabirauf/icsharp/wiki/Installation...下面逆天带搭建搭建下Linux下环境(官方方法有问题) CSharp交互式编程 1.安装mono部分组件 先看看官方仓库,如果你不是Ubuntu自己切换下源 安装mono部分组件,写段shell脚本...mono-runtime-dbg -y # 导入证书 mozroots --import --machine --sync # 查看mono版本 mono --version 看到这个就代表安装完成了 2.安装Jupyter-notebook...这部之前说过了,你安装了conda之后什么都有了,可以参考之前我写一篇文章: Anaconda For Linux 3.环境配置 下载release包: https://github.com/gyurisc...文件 输入代码,shift+回车运行 其他自己摸索摸索吧,先这样了~

    1.7K30

    Jupyter Notebook入门

    Jupyter Notebook入门简介Jupyter Notebook是一种交互式计算环境,能够让用户在浏览器编写和执行代码,并与代码运行结果、文本、图像、视频等进行交互。...Notebook基本结构在Jupyter Notebook,用户可以创建一个名为"Notebook"文件,该文件以​​.ipynb​​后缀结尾。...本文提供了Jupyter Notebook基本概念、使用方法以及一些常用技巧。希望读者们能够通过本文了解并开始使用Jupyter Notebook,并发现其在工作和学习价值和便利。...可维护性: Jupyter Notebook代码和文本通常被混在一起,这样会导致代码可读性和维护性降低。...安全性: Jupyter Notebook默认设置是允许在浏览器执行任意代码,这可能会导致安全风险。如果运行了不受信任Notebook文件,可能会导致恶意代码执行。

    51130

    jupyter notebook玩转Markdown目录

    作者:Peter 编辑:Peter 大家好,我是Peter~ 今天给大家介绍一个Peter日常操作jupyter使用技巧:如何在jupyter notebook玩转Markdown目录。...2、单击上面提到齿轮 勾选下面的add notebook ToC cell,并自定义名称: 图片 3、新效果展示 同样单击目录【红框任何一级目录,也是可以跳转到指定位置 图片 这个功能我一般不使用...,习惯了左侧目录 左侧目录右移 jupyter notebook默认生成目录是在左边,我们也可以移动到右边。...注意一点:需要你光标移动到左侧目录时候变成十字架形式,具体到视频号内容 参考资料 本文中介绍了jupyter notebook如何制作和玩转Markdown目录,需要先掌握两个知识点: 1、如何使用...Markdown语法编写目录 2、在jupyter notebook如何使用Markdown,请参考小屋里面关于Jupyter notebook中介绍文章。

    1.1K00

    Jupyter Notebook(下篇)

    Jupyter Notebook是一个基于Web交互式工具,数据科学领域正在频繁使用它。...在上篇文章,我们介绍了如何安装使用Jupyter Notebook来快快乐乐编程,以及一些快捷键sao操作、如何搭建一个开放notebook让大家一起使用,最后我们介绍了怎样修改Jupyter Notebook...通过上篇介绍,相信大家已经可以自如使用Jupyter了,今天我们继续介绍一下Jupyter Notebook一些更酷扩展功能。...这个命令用于将matplotlib输出图嵌入到notebook,如果不加这条命令,在用matplotlib绘图时可能会出现不显示情况,举个我们在介绍seaborn例子: import seaborn...:可以在jupyter实现help功能。 np.random.rand??

    1.6K10

    Jupyter Notebook配置多版本Python

    配置 Jupyter Notebook 支持 Python 3.7 2.1 切换到 python37 环境 # Windows activate python37 # Mac source...添加 python37 环境 # 其实 --name 只是指定一个在 Jupyter display_name 而已,一定要确保当前已切换到 python37 环境 # 调用是 python ,...添加到 Jupyter ,就要切换到哪个环境,再执行 此条语句将 ipykernel 指向当前环境 且 注册到 Jupyter 执行上方后,就会导致下图所示,解决:将其修改为默认路径即可 D...\AppData\Roaming\jupyter\kernels\python3 C:\ProgramData\jupyter\kernels\python37 查看 kernel.json Python...Jupyter Notebook Kernel 管理 4.1 查看安装内核和位置 jupyter kernelspec list C:3 为 anaconda3 默认安装后 jupyter配置文件地址

    4.5K20
    领券